Ticket: Staging env misconfigured for Siftgate bloom filter

The bloom layer in front of the Pellet KV store is rejecting all lookups in staging because the env file was copied from the dev template without credentials. False-positive tuning values are fine; only the auth line is missing. To unblock the weekly demo, the Pellet admission secret must be set on the following line.

env line for yaguf-fajop: LEDGER_TOKEN13=fb08984397349

Ticket: Missed pick-up — raffle drums

Hi, quick one for you. The two raffle drums for the Fernleigh staff party were supposed to go out with yesterday's afternoon run from the Oakton annex, but the driver never showed and the drums are still sitting by the goods lift. The party committee is getting twitchy since the draw is Friday. Can you rebook the collection for tomorrow morning and flag it as priority? The confidential hand-over instruction for the courier is noted directly below.

courier memo of yahif-faweg: the quenael tamius courier leaves the prawyn jorix kaswyn istox silmir brieth zormir fenvan ledger at gate 3145 under passcode 231062

**Vendor note: Inkmill markdown pipeline**

Rendering for Parchway docs is outsourced to Inkmill under an annual contract, renewing each March. They handle sanitization and PDF export; we own the upload queue. SLA: 4-hour response on rendering failures. Escalate only after two failed retries. Their support desk is reachable at the address below.

billing contact of hahaf-baguf = zorael.tammir.jorius@sivrelhq.internal

# RateLens — Contacts for Release Managers

RateLens is Bramblehost's hotel rate-parity checker. It crawls partner booking pages nightly and flags discrepancies against contracted rates. Releases ship Tuesdays; the crawler and the comparison engine deploy separately, so coordinate both owners before cutting a tag. Schema changes require a heads-up to the data team at least two days in advance. For release sign-off or rollback questions, contact the team inbox below.

billing contact of kagaf-bahif = fraox_ralvan_tamwyn@zemvarcloud.local